About 31 Bartlemas Road
31 Bartlemas Road is a four-bedroom mid-terrace house in Oxford (OX4 1XU). It has a recorded floor area of 135 m² (around 1453 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(July 2020) shows a D (score 59),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in July 2016 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and lighting went from Average to Very Good; while window efficiency dropped from Poor to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78). Period features are noted in the property record.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
Sold August 2018 for £735,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. 3 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 135 m² it's 21.5% larger than the typical home in the postcode (111 m² median across 30 EPCs). Across 1996–2018, sale prices on this property compounded at 9.8%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£890,000 is 21.1% above the 2018 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£506/sq ft) was about 81.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ode.

Planning history
31 Bartlemas Road has 2 separate extension applications on the council record.
- Aug 2025ExtensionOutlineIn report
Extension: Single storey · Rear of property
Application to certify that the proposed erection of a single storey rear extension and alterations to rear fenestration is lawful development.

- Jul 2025ExtensionOutlineIn report
Extension: Single storey · Rear of property
Application for prior approval for the erection of a single storey rear extension, which would extend beyond the rear wall of the original house by 6.00m, for which the maximum height would be 3.70m, and for which the height of the eaves would be 2.50m.
